    You're going to experience more vibration from the fronts. I'd just take one wheel off and see if the hub fits flushly into wheel then you'll know if that's the problem. Pretty easy to rule it out that way. Make sure there's no gap between the hub and the wheel when the lug nuts are off.

    Was there a beeping sound that came on? When VSC is activated when turning, there should be a beeping as well as throttle/brakes coming on and off. I had this issue with 285's on my 2011 even after resetting. I couldn't even make a u-turn without it going off.

    For the vibrating issue, I'd just switch wheels with a another tacoma, 4runner, etc.. that has stock wheel/tire size and determine if it has the same symptoms.
